House Bill 4693 of 2003

Sponsors

Categories

Education: other; State agencies (existing): education; Education: school districts
Education; other; educational flexibility and empowerment contracts waiving certain statutory and administrative requirements as part of performance contract; allow. Amends 1976 PA 451 (MCL 380.1 - 380.1852) by adding sec. 1294.

History

(House actions in lowercase, Senate actions in UPPERCASE)
Note: A page number of 0 indicates that the page number is coming soon
Date Journal Action
5/15/2003 HJ 40 Pg. 604 referred to Committee on Education
6/04/2003 HJ 47 Pg. 725 reported with recommendation with substitute H-1
6/04/2003 HJ 47 Pg. 725 referred to second reading
6/19/2003 HJ 54 Pg. 953 substitute H-1 adopted and amended
6/19/2003 HJ 54 Pg. 953 placed on third reading
6/19/2003 HJ 54 Pg. 954 placed on immediate passage
6/19/2003 HJ 54 Pg. 954 passed; given immediate effect Roll Call # 278 Yeas 56 Nays 49
6/24/2003 SJ 62 Pg. 973 REFERRED TO COMMITTEE ON EDUCATION
1/27/2004 SJ 6 Pg. 69 REPORTED FAVORABLY WITH SUBSTITUTE S-1
2/05/2004 SJ 11 Pg. 111 REPORTED BY CO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E FAVORABLY WITH SUBSTITUTE S-1 AND AMENDMENT(S)
2/05/2004 SJ 11 Pg. 111 SUBSTITUTE S-1 AS AMENDED CONCURRED IN
2/05/2004 SJ 11 Pg. 111 PLACED ON ORDER OF THIRD READING WITH SUBSTITUTE S-1 AS AMENDED
2/05/2004 SJ 11 Pg. 111 PLACED ON IMMEDIATE PASSAGE
2/05/2004 SJ 11 Pg. 111 PASSED ROLL CALL # 25 YEAS 23 NAYS 13 EXCUSED 2 NOT VOTING 0
2/05/2004 SJ 11 Pg. 111 IMMEDIATE EFFECT DEFEATED
2/05/2004 SJ 11 Pg. 111 INSERTED FULL TITLE
2/10/2004 HJ 10 Pg. 128 Senate substitute S-1 concurred in
2/10/2004 HJ 10 Pg. 128 Roll Call # 32 Yeas 59 Nays 47
2/10/2004 HJ 10 Pg. 128 full title agreed to
2/10/2004 HJ 10 Pg. 128 bill ordered enrolled
2/17/2004 HJ 13 Pg. 204 presented to the Governor 2/13/2004 @ 2:40 PM
3/09/2004 HJ 19 Pg. 318 vetoed by the Governor 02/20/2004
3/09/2004 HJ 19 Pg. 318 re-referred to Committee on Education
